Mental Health Counselor

Hinds Community College

Mental Health CounselorThe Mental Health Counselor will provide developmental and educational support to students, or other clients of the college, in the form of short-term personal counseling; provide counseling services to students in a manner that demonstrates a commitment to the Community College mission and its diverse student population. Through a comprehensive, student-centered counseling approach, to develop and present structured groups for positive growth; to develop, monitor, and provide in-service training in counseling support programs; and to do related work as required. Ability to utilize a wide range of assessment instruments for personal, career, and educational issues.The Mental Health Counselor plays a critical role as part of the Mental Health Services department. The Mental Health Counselor is responsible for providing clinical mental health services. This includes providing clinical mental health counseling in the individual and group setting, the development, implementation, and evaluation of policies, procedures, and programs, as well as consulting with faculty, staff, and administration over mental health topics. The Mental Health Counselor will participate in developing proactive mental health and wellness programming for the entire college population and assist with staff training as needed.Provide individual and group mental health counseling services to the student population, including evaluation, development, and facilitation of support groups, and making referrals to external clinicians as needed. Develop mental health programs in conjunction with the Dean of Student Services. Facilitate training and psycho-educational workshops for students, faculty, and staff. Maintain confidential clinical schedule and case files. Attend ongoing trainings as required (current updated license, etc.) Assist in the development, support, and supervision of interns, if applicable. Ability to adhere to college policies and procedures. Ability to handle confidential information with discretion. Should be committed to a culture of diversity, respect, and inclusion. General knowledge of the College's mission, purpose, goals, and the role this position plays in achieving those goals.
